Transaction 17538478902848ffd836cc94fc7152fdf4c4a2c2ea42067e8debc9ef565d63d4
1 Input
1 Output
-
17538478902848ffd836cc94fc7152fdf4c4a2c2ea42067e8debc9ef565d63d4:0
- value
- 204200
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4502594433414cbe4a7d194e2b6a9284c8379d36 OP_EQUAL
- address
- 37yuMyEbN3FokPB3JA645S3Hrc93Rwodt3